What companies run services between Amsterdam, Netherlands and Pulheim, Germany?

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S) operates a train from Amsterdam Centraal to Koeln Hbf every 3 hours. Tickets cost €40–140 and the journey takes 2h 38m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Amsterdam Centraal Station to Pulheim Bf via Essen Hbf, Südviertel, Essen, Köln-Ehrenfeld Gleis, and Köln Ehrenfeld Bf Ehrenfeld in around 4h 39m.
